Form 4: Day One Biopharmaceuticals Director Saira Ramasastry Granted 37,500 Equity Awards

Sentiment:

Insider Transaction Report


Day One Biopharmaceuticals, Inc. Director Saira Ramasastry was granted 22,500 stock options and 15,000 restricted stock units, aligning her interests with shareholders.

Summary

  • Saira Ramasastry, a Director of Day One Biopharmaceuticals, Inc. (DAWN), was granted 22,500 stock options and 15,000 deferred restricted stock units (RSUs) on June 2, 2025.
  • The stock options have an exercise price of $7.01 and are set to vest at a rate of 1/12th of the total grant monthly, beginning July 2, 2025, subject to her continued service, and will expire on June 1, 2035.
  • The 15,000 RSUs represent a contingent right to receive one share of the Issuer's Common Stock for no consideration and will vest 100% on the earlier of June 2, 2026, or the Issuer's 2026 annual meeting of stockholders, also subject to her continued service.
  • Upon RSU vesting, they will automatically convert into an equal number of deferred stock units, which are scheduled to be settled for an equal number of shares of Common Stock on the earlier of calendar year 2030 or the Reporting Person's separation from the Issuer, with provisions for earlier settlement in cases of death, disability, or unforeseeable emergency.
